Hurts avoids endorsement of Eagles OC Patullo

Associated PressJan 12, 2026, 06:28 PM ETEmailPrintOpen Extended ReactionsPHILADELPHIA -- With his season over after a failed Super Bowl repeat bid, Jalen Hurts sounded like a quarterback who's ready for a fifth Philadelphia Eagles offensive coordinator in five seasons. Hurts didn't give an endorsement for the beleaguered Kevin Patullo, whose house was egged earlier this season as he became the top target for Eagles fans' frustrations, a day after last season's Super Bowl champions were knocked out of the playoffs in the wild-card round by the San Francisco 49ers. Hurts declined a chance to stump for Patullo and instead put the decision on Eagles coach Nick Sirianni, general manager Howie Roseman and owner Jeffrey Lurie. Hurts was asked if he wanted Patullo back."It's too soon to think about that," Hurts said Monday as the Eagles cleaned out their lockers. "I put my trust in Howie. Howie, Nick and Mr.
